Skip to content

Commit c6167bb

Browse files
author
bearyan
committed
fix isAndroid不生效的问题 Tencent#111
1 parent c3e1617 commit c6167bb

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/actionSheet/actionSheet.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-62,7 +62,7 @@ function actionSheet(menus = [], actions = [], options = {}) {
6262
function _hide(callback){
6363
_hide = $.noop; // 防止二次调用导致报错
6464

65-
$actionSheet.addClass(isAndroid ? 'weui-animate-fade-out' : 'weui-animate-slide-down');
65+
$actionSheet.addClass(options.isAndroid ? 'weui-animate-fade-out' : 'weui-animate-slide-down');
6666
$actionSheetMask
6767
.addClass('weui-animate-fade-out')
6868
.on('animationend webkitAnimationEnd', function () {
@@ -78,7 +78,7 @@ function actionSheet(menus = [], actions = [], options = {}) {
7878
// 这里获取一下计算后的样式,强制触发渲染. fix IOS10下闪现的问题
7979
$.getStyle($actionSheet[0], 'transform');
8080

81-
$actionSheet.addClass(isAndroid ? 'weui-animate-fade-in' : 'weui-animate-slide-up');
81+
$actionSheet.addClass(options.isAndroid ? 'weui-animate-fade-in' : 'weui-animate-slide-up');
8282
$actionSheetMask
8383
.addClass('weui-animate-fade-in')
8484
.on('click', function () { hide(); });

0 commit comments

Comments
 (0)